The Maricopa County Bar Association (MCBA) is a voluntary professional association serving the legal community in Phoenix, Arizona. Founded in 1914, it is the largest voluntary bar association in Arizona and facilitates professional connections through continuing legal education, social events, and charitable activities. It operates within the legal services sector and is based in Phoenix. Membership in MCBA is voluntary, in contrast with mandatory membership in the State Bar for licensed attorneys, and the organization supports professional growth and public service through its sections and divisions and its governance structure. The Volunteer Lawyers Program is a division of Community Legal Services, conducted in partnership with MCBA.
